Prime Minister Ehud Olmert is running out of time to screw things up. Unlike Bush, who was in the Olympics so he could not cause any more trouble in the US, Olmert offered up 97% of the West Bank and some land in the Negev adjacent to Gaza for a new state called “Palestine”.

His plan would keep 7% of the West Bank and give the same amount of land near Gaza. The catch, Palestine can have no army and Hamas has to be removed from control of Gaza before any land transfers to Abbas will take place.

Because of the Hamas thing, it will be tough for Fatah to live up to their part. However, Israel did make an offer. Sounds like 1948, but the offer was rejected then too.
